Misaligned Teeth
If you have misaligned teeth, you can straighten them with orthodontic treatments. Jagged teeth can cause different concerns, including difficulty in cleaning them effectively, raised danger of dental caries and gum disease, and also problems with speech or chewing.
Orthodontic treatments, such as braces or clear aligners, can help deal with the positioning of your teeth. Braces are constructed from steel brackets and wires that apply mild pressure to relocate your teeth into their proper position. Clear aligners, on the other hand, are customized plastic trays that gradually shift your teeth.
Both choices work in straightening out crooked teeth, but the option relies on your specific demands and preferences. Consulting with an orthodontist will assist determine the best therapy prepare for you.
Overcrowding
Are your teeth jammed, triggering pain and trouble in preserving great dental health? Congestion is a typical orthodontic trouble that takes place when there wants space in your mouth for all your teeth to fit properly. This can cause a range of concerns, from uneven teeth to bite troubles.
Fortunately, there are a number of efficient solutions to deal with overcrowding:
1. ** Tooth removal **: Sometimes, removing several teeth might be needed to create even more room in your mouth.
2. ** Growth home appliances **: These devices are utilized to broaden the arch of your mouth, allowing your teeth to align correctly.
3. ** Orthodontic therapy **: Dental braces or clear aligners can progressively shift your teeth into their correct placements, alleviating overcrowding and enhancing your smile.
Attending to congestion is necessary not only for visual reasons however likewise for your overall dental health. Speak with an orthodontist to identify the very best strategy for your certain situation.
Spaces In Between Teeth
To resolve the problem of overcrowding, an additional usual orthodontic issue arises: voids between your teeth. Voids between teeth, also called diastemas, can take place for numerous reasons.
One common reason is a disparity in the dimension of the teeth and the jawbone. This can result in gaps in between the teeth, particularly in the front teeth. Another cause can be missing out on or small teeth, which can create rooms in your smile. Additionally, habits such as thumb sucking or tongue thrusting can also add to the growth of voids.
To fix this concern, orthodontic treatments such as braces or clear aligners can be used to gradually shut the spaces and align your teeth correctly. Sometimes, dental bonding or veneers may be recommended to fill in the voids and enhance the look of your smile.
Bite Issues
Dealing with bite issues is essential for appropriate positioning and feature of your teeth. If you're experiencing bite issues, it is very important to seek orthodontic treatment to resolve the trouble.
Below are three common bite problems and how they can be taken care of:
1. Overbite: An overbite occurs when your upper front teeth overlap substantially with your reduced front teeth. This can result in problems with attacking and chewing. Orthodontic treatment, such as dental braces or Invisalign, can help deal with an overbite by gradually relocating the teeth into their proper setting.
2. Underbite: An underbite is when your reduced front teeth stick out in front of your top teeth. This can influence the look of your smile and can trigger difficulties with biting and eating. Orthodontic therapy may involve using dental braces or various other home appliances to move the lower teeth back and align them correctly with the top teeth.
3. Crossbite: A crossbite is when your top teeth rest inside your reduced teeth when you attack down. This can cause uneven endure the teeth and can bring about jaw pain. Orthodontic therapy for a crossbite might include using braces or various other devices to straighten the teeth and correct the bite.
Misaligned Jaw
If you have a misaligned jaw, orthodontic therapy can aid straighten it for boosted bite and jaw function. A misaligned jaw occurs when the upper and lower jaws do not fulfill appropriately. This can result in different problems, such as problem chewing, speaking, and also breathing.
Orthodontists can utilize different techniques to deal with a misaligned jaw, relying on the severity of the problem. One common technique is using dental braces or aligners to gradually shift the position of the teeth and align the jaws. In much more serious situations, orthognathic surgical procedure may be necessary to reposition the jawbones and accomplish appropriate alignment.
It is very important to speak with an orthodontist to determine the most effective therapy plan for your misaligned jaw.
